Transaction 531a6459175b7c4dbaa37ba0484525111f62f3f5e57afc1054954c12777b1f98

1 Input
2 Outputs
  • 531a6459175b7c4dbaa37ba0484525111f62f3f5e57afc1054954c12777b1f98:0
  • value  22794620
    address  14VtYZ3T4siKiSxpuRJd3NZMhrDp9djtfS
  • 531a6459175b7c4dbaa37ba0484525111f62f3f5e57afc1054954c12777b1f98:1
  • value  1355786203
    address  1KuwDt57KNMZg6uhvuSGc1GLzsAGALpp76